Hurst are pleased to bring to the market this detached family home, that has been extended and provides versatile and extremely spacious accommodation throughout and makes for an ideal family home. The open plan kitchen/breakfast/dining room gives a bright, open feel that leads into a huge conservatory area that is multi-functional and has French doors leading onto the rear garden. This superb family home is situated in a popular part of the town and within walking distance of The Royal Grammar School and approximately half a mile from the town centre and the main line railway station that offers a direct line service into London Marylebone, making it perfect for those looking to commute. The accommodation includes; entrance hall, spacious double aspect sitting room with views across the valley and National Trust parkland, open plan and modern fitted kitchen/diner with sliding doors opening into a conservatory, master bedroom with en-suite bathroom, three further bedrooms and family bathroom. The property further benefits from; gas central heating, double glazing, block paved driveway parking for several vehicles, single garage, large rear garden that is tiered and provides a couple of areas that are perfect for entertaining and also provides a very secluded feel. This really is a superb family home in an idyllic and rural feel to this part of the town which also provides miles of countryside walks on your doorstep and an internal viewing is advised.
